Posted that I got hired a week ago after a year of searching. Lost my job 8 DAYS IN!!!

This is a doozy of a story. So I just posted about a week ago that I got a job at a game store as their event coordinator. When I was getting hired, he told me he wanted "boots on the ground, events planned right away". So... I did. I scheduled 7 awesome events in a week. Cozy gaming nights, Ren Fest Market, Retro Gaming Pajama Party, Nerdy Singles Night, Party Finder Party, etc. On the 8th day, he sat down and said "I don't think this is going to work out".

I asked what I did wrong, and he said, "It's not you; you're the best event coordinator I've ever hired. You did exactly what I asked for. It's my customers. They feel pushed out with the events that have been planned, and I read my audience wrong. I thought the events that you brought were a great idea, but my weekly customers are panicking and messaging me all week, saying they don't want this."

So... I'm out of a job. Again. I just got an interview today at a non-profit; however, they said they got 200 applications and are interviewing many people from that list—and I only have 3 years of experience as an event planner... so there will definitely be someone with more experience than me. I am almost out of savings. I don't know what I'm going to do. I was so excited, and now, because I did my job so well, I'm OUT OF A JOB AGAIN.

Edit: for clarity, I am female. Just letting everyone know because there's a lot of dude, man, bud type comments. 😅

Also, I forgot to mention that it's also a space issue, which my boss should have thought about before hiring me. 🫠

He also told me he wants me on contract, which could be 0 hours a month or 15 hours a month. Super inconsistent. But it's something I guess. I really need a full-time job though. 😭😭

The Romantasy Ball was amazing 😍🌹

I hosted a Romantasy Ball in my home town, Minneapolis MN. We had authors selling books, vendors selling fantasy wares, TWO photo booths, henna, tarot reading, themed cocktails/mocktails, themed food, dance lessons at the top of the hour, and pop music we could dance to at the bottom of the hour. 60 people bought tickets and many wanted another one!! (Definitely in the spring). I'm so happy!!! So much work was put into this. Hours of planning, setting up, take down... It was all worth it.
